From 19d18fdfc79217c86802271c9ce5b4ed174628cc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001 From: Tao Chen Date: Wed, 16 Jul 2025 21:46:53 +0800 Subject: bpf: Add struct bpf_token_info The 'commit 35f96de04127 ("bpf: Introduce BPF token object")' added BPF token as a new kind of BPF kernel object. And BPF_OBJ_GET_INFO_BY_FD already used to get BPF object info, so we can also get token info with this cmd. One usage scenario, when program runs failed with token, because of the permission failure, we can report what BPF token is allowing with this API for debugging.
